Home » Soup » Creamy Tomato Soup Recipe

Creamy Tomato Soup Recipe

Oh, how I love a good bowl of tomato soup! It’s one of those nostalgic flavors that instantly takes me back to cozy evenings, chilly days, and the simple joy of a warm hug in a bowl. And let me tell you, this creamy tomato soup recipe is pure magic. It’s ridiculously easy to make, comes together surprisingly fast, and the flavor is just out of this world. Forget those canned versions; this homemade creamy tomato soup is a game-changer!

Why You’ll Love Creamy Tomato Soup

  • Fast: Ready in under 30 minutes, perfect for busy weeknights.
  • Easy: Simple steps that anyone can follow, even kitchen newbies!
  • Giftable: Make a big batch and share it with friends or neighbors – it’s the perfect homemade gift.
  • Crowd-pleasing: From picky eaters to seasoned foodies, everyone adores this creamy, dreamy soup.

Ingredients

Gathering your ingredients is the first step to soup bliss. Here’s what you’ll need:

  • 4 Tbsp unsalted butter: For that rich, buttery base.
  • 2 yellow onions, finely chopped: The unsung heroes of flavor!
  • 3 garlic cloves, minced: Because garlic makes everything better.
  • 56 oz crushed tomatoes, with their juice: The star of the show! Using crushed tomatoes gives you a lovely texture.
  • 2 cups chicken stock: Adds depth and savoriness.
  • 1/4 cup chopped fresh basil, plus more for serving: Fresh herbs just elevate everything, don’t they?
  • 1 Tbsp sugar, or to taste: Just a touch to balance the acidity of the tomatoes.
  • 1/2 tsp black pepper, or to taste: For a little kick.
  • 1/2 cup heavy whipping cream, or to taste: This is what makes it wonderfully creamy!
  • 1/3 cup freshly grated Parmesan cheese, plus more for serving: For that salty, cheesy goodness.

How to Make Creamy Tomato Soup

Alright, let’s get cooking! This is where the magic happens. It’s so straightforward, you’ll wonder why you haven’t made it sooner.

  1. Sauté the Aromatics

    Grab a nice big pot, preferably nonreactive or an enameled Dutch oven. Heat it over medium heat. Toss in your butter, and once it’s melted and bubbly, add the chopped onions. Let them sauté for about 10-12 minutes, stirring every now and then, until they’re soft and have a lovely golden hue. This step is key for developing great flavor! Then, add your minced garlic and cook for just about 1 minute until it’s nice and fragrant. Be careful not to burn the garlic – nobody likes bitter soup!

  2. Simmer to Perfection

    Now, pour in the crushed tomatoes with all their juice. Add the chicken stock, the chopped fresh basil, the sugar, and the black pepper. Give everything a good stir to combine. Bring the mixture to a boil, then reduce the heat to low, cover it partially, and let it simmer for about 10 minutes. This allows all those wonderful flavors to meld together beautifully.

  3. Blend it Smooth (or Not!)

    Here’s where you get to decide your soup’s texture! If you have an immersion blender, this is your time to shine. Stick it into the pot and blend until the soup is as smooth as you like it. If you don’t have an immersion blender, no worries! You can carefully transfer the soup to a regular blender in batches. Just be super cautious – never overfill a blender with hot liquids. Pulse a few times to start, and then blend until smooth. Once blended, pour the soup back into the pot. If you’re looking for other smooth and comforting dishes, our creamy Cajun chicken rigatoni pasta is another fantastic option!

  4. The Creamy Finish

    Turn the heat back up to medium. Stir in the heavy whipping cream and the freshly grated Parmesan cheese. Gently bring the soup back to a simmer – don’t let it boil rapidly now. Taste it and add salt and pepper if you think it needs it. Turn off the heat. That’s it! So easy, right?

  5. Serve and Enjoy!

    Ladle your warm, inviting soup into bowls. Garnish with a sprinkle of extra Parmesan cheese and some more fresh chopped basil. It’s like a little party in every spoonful! This soup is absolutely divine served with a grilled cheese sandwich or some crusty bread. For a truly comforting meal, consider pairing it with something like our best fried bologna sandwich recipe!

Substitutions & Additions

This recipe is wonderfully flexible! Don’t have chicken stock? Vegetable stock works like a charm. Want it richer? Add a splash more cream. Feeling adventurous? Here are a few ideas:

  • Spice it Up: Add a pinch of red pepper flakes along with the black pepper for a touch of heat.
  • Herbalicious: Experiment with other fresh herbs like thyme or a bay leaf while it simmers.
  • Cheesy Goodness: Stir in a handful of shredded cheddar or mozzarella cheese at the end for extra meltiness.
  • Veggie Boost: Add a diced carrot or celery stalk with the onions for extra depth of flavor and nutrients.

Tips for Success

A few little tricks can make your soup even more spectacular:

  • Don’t Rush the Onions: Taking the time to gently sauté the onions until golden caramelizes them and builds a fantastic flavor base.
  • Watch the Heat: When blending hot liquids, always be cautious and don’t overfill your blender.
  • Taste and Adjust: Always taste your soup before serving and adjust seasonings as needed. Tomatoes can vary in acidity and sweetness.
  • Prep Ahead: You can chop your onions and mince your garlic the day before to save time on cooking day. If you’re preparing for a crowd, consider making this amazing soup alongside something sweet, like our easy cake mix toffee bars.

How to Store Creamy Tomato Soup

Got leftovers? Lucky you! You can store this creamy tomato soup in an airtight container in the refrigerator for up to 3-4 days. When you’re ready to reheat, do so gently on the stovetop over low heat, stirring occasionally. You might need to add a splash of water or broth if it’s too thick. If you want to freeze it, let it cool completely, then transfer it to freezer-safe containers or bags. It should keep well in the freezer for about 2-3 months. Just thaw it in the fridge overnight before reheating.

FAQs

  • Can I make this soup vegan?

    Absolutely! You can swap the butter for olive oil or vegan butter, use vegetable stock instead of chicken stock, and substitute the heavy cream with full-fat coconut milk or cashew cream. Omit the Parmesan or use a vegan alternative.

  • Can I use fresh tomatoes instead of crushed tomatoes?

    You can! You’ll need about 3-4 pounds of ripe fresh tomatoes. Core them, roughly chop them, and add them to the pot. You might need to simmer them a little longer to break down, and you may want to add a bit more stock or water if it seems too thick.

  • What kind of pot is best for making tomato soup?

    A heavy-bottomed pot like a Dutch oven or an enameled cast-iron pot is ideal. They distribute heat evenly, which helps prevent scorching and ensures your onions sauté beautifully.

  • Can I make this soup ahead of time?

    Yes! You can make the soup a day or two in advance. The flavors often meld even better overnight. Just reheat it gently on the stove. You may want to add a little extra cream or broth when reheating if it has thickened.

I hope you adore this creamy tomato soup as much as I do! It’s a simple recipe that brings so much comfort and joy. If you enjoyed this, be sure to check out more delicious recipes and inspiration on our Pinterest!

Creamy Tomato Soup

Ridiculously easy to make, comes together surprisingly fast, and the flavor is just out of this world. Forget those canned versions; this homemade creamy tomato soup is a game-changer!
Prep Time 15 minutes
Cook Time 20 minutes
Total Time 35 minutes
Course Soup
Cuisine American
Servings 6 servings

Equipment

  • Large Pot
  • Immersion Blender
  • Regular Blender (optional)

Ingredients
  

  • 4 Tbsp 4 Tbsp unsalted butter For that rich, buttery base.
  • 2 2 yellow onions, finely chopped The unsung heroes of flavor!
  • 3 3 garlic cloves, minced Because garlic makes everything better.
  • 56 oz 56 oz crushed tomatoes, with their juice The star of the show! Using crushed tomatoes gives you a lovely texture.
  • 2 cups 2 cups chicken stock Adds depth and savoriness.
  • 0.25 cup 1/4 cup chopped fresh basil, plus more for serving Fresh herbs just elevate everything, don't they?
  • 1 Tbsp 1 Tbsp sugar, or to taste Just a touch to balance the acidity of the tomatoes.
  • 0.5 tsp 1/2 tsp black pepper, or to taste For a little kick.
  • 0.5 cup 1/2 cup heavy whipping cream, or to taste This is what makes it wonderfully creamy!
  • 0.33 cup 1/3 cup freshly grated Parmesan cheese, plus more for serving For that salty, cheesy goodness.

Instructions
 

  • Grab a nice big pot, preferably nonreactive or an enameled Dutch oven. Heat it over medium heat. Toss in your butter, and once it’s melted and bubbly, add the chopped onions. Let them sauté for about 10-12 minutes, stirring every now and then, until they’re soft and have a lovely golden hue. This step is key for developing great flavor! Then, add your minced garlic and cook for just about 1 minute until it’s nice and fragrant. Be careful not to burn the garlic – nobody likes bitter soup!
  • Now, pour in the crushed tomatoes with all their juice. Add the chicken stock, the chopped fresh basil, the sugar, and the black pepper. Give everything a good stir to combine. Bring the mixture to a boil, then reduce the heat to low, cover it partially, and let it simmer for about 10 minutes. This allows all those wonderful flavors to meld together beautifully.
  • Here’s where you get to decide your soup’s texture! If you have an immersion blender, this is your time to shine. Stick it into the pot and blend until the soup is as smooth as you like it. If you don't have an immersion blender, no worries! You can carefully transfer the soup to a regular blender in batches. Just be super cautious – never overfill a blender with hot liquids. Pulse a few times to start, and then blend until smooth. Once blended, pour the soup back into the pot. If you're looking for other smooth and comforting dishes, our creamy Cajun chicken rigatoni pasta is another fantastic option!
  • Turn the heat back up to medium. Stir in the heavy whipping cream and the freshly grated Parmesan cheese. Gently bring the soup back to a simmer – don’t let it boil rapidly now. Taste it and add salt and pepper if you think it needs it. Turn off the heat. That’s it! So easy, right?
  • Ladle your warm, inviting soup into bowls. Garnish with a sprinkle of extra Parmesan cheese and some more fresh chopped basil. It’s like a little party in every spoonful! This soup is absolutely divine served with a grilled cheese sandwich or some crusty bread. For a truly comforting meal, consider pairing it with something like our best fried bologna sandwich recipe!

Notes

This recipe is wonderfully flexible! Don't have chicken stock? Vegetable stock works like a charm. Want it richer? Add a splash more cream. Feeling adventurous? Here are a few ideas: Spice it Up: Add a pinch of red pepper flakes along with the black pepper for a touch of heat. Herbalicious: Experiment with other fresh herbs like thyme or a bay leaf while it simmers. Cheesy Goodness: Stir in a handful of shredded cheddar or mozzarella cheese at the end for extra meltiness. Veggie Boost: Add a diced carrot or celery stalk with the onions for extra depth of flavor and nutrients.
Keyword Creamy Soup, Easy Soup, Tomato Soup

Leave a Comment

Recipe Rating